Transaction 6680f169e5be4fc3be6a3b37edc54c49dc8d7786b41abaccfd0f62fb3c268de7

18 Input
2 Outputs
  • 6680f169e5be4fc3be6a3b37edc54c49dc8d7786b41abaccfd0f62fb3c268de7:0
  • value  668985505
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 6680f169e5be4fc3be6a3b37edc54c49dc8d7786b41abaccfd0f62fb3c268de7:1
  • value  821041
    address  3CpiWrLE7LunXkq3mhX3sScasJuxTgrjN4